European Networks of Cultural and Creative Organisations
The European Networks of Cultural and Creative Organisations program, part of the Creative Europe initiative, aimed to empower Europe's cultural and creative sectors. This closed call sought to enhance capacities, foster innovation, and generate growth within these vital industries by supporting highly representative, multi-country networks.

Type and Scope of Funding
This section describes the financial support provided by the European Networks of Cultural and Creative Organisations program, which primarily offered grants. While a total budget was allocated, specific per-project funding amounts were not detailed, but the program aimed to support approximately 30 networks.
